An Electronic Health Record (EHR) is a digital system that enhances efficiency in patient care and practice management. For rheumatologists, juggling complex autoimmune and musculoskeletal conditions can be overwhelming, from writing clinical notes to managing lab results, imaging, medication schedules, and billing.
A specialized EHR tailored for rheumatology simplifies these tasks by boosting patient engagement, coordinating care, and optimizing practice growth. With 3Y Health’s rheumatology EHR, you have a platform that adapts to your needs, allowing you to focus on providing exceptional care.
